 * Second, regarding the Post Assistant and direct edits: taking automated actions
   requires Function Calling. Ensuring Function Calling remains stable and compatible
   across constantly updating LLM models is incredibly difficut. It requires continuous
   maintenance, testing, and dedicated support.
 * Because of the massive amount of work required to keep Function Calling operational,
   it is entirely unsustainable to offer it for free. That is why it is a Pro feature.
   It is not _greed_; it is the reality of maintaining complex software.
